PAUL:
Now in 2007 you can see Paul perform with The Fabulous Boogie Band, Dr JJs Blues Band, Geoff Achison and the UK Soul Diggers, Bob Bowles, Sam Kelly, Primo Blues, Collette Wilkinson, 3rd Degree Leburn, Loose Change, Nigel Bagge, Rik Waller, Station House, The UK Funk All Stars , and his own band The Funkskateers. Paul also regularly sits in for other keyboard players and drummers too. Please see the "Upcoming Shows" for more information.

Support Gigs:

Paul has supported Herbie Goins, Roy Rogers, Ruby Turner, Walter Trout, Mike Sanchez, Dana Gillespie & John Mayall and the Blues Breakers

Airplay

25/02/2004: BBC Radio 2 "The Paul Jones Show" Session with Trafficker.

10/06/2004: BBC Radio Wales: Trafficker album Natures Most Wanted was album of the week.

11/11/2004: BBC Radio 2 "The Paul Jones Show" Session with Trafficker.

14/12/2004: BBC Radio 2 "The Paul Jones Show" Live session with Trafficker at the Buttermarket, Shrewsbury.

03/03/2007: BBC 6 Music "The Craig Charles Funk & Soul Show" Session With Cymande

Recording sessions

Paul has recorded with Tommy Allen (Trafficker / Sugababes), Tom Palmer, Grant "Cheeky" Tunbridge (Trafficker and Nicky Moore's Blues Corporation), Nigel Bagge, Richard Studholme, Sam Kelly (UK Drummer of the year for past 5 years and drummer for 70's "nyah Rock" band Cymande ), Collette Wilkinson (of Funk band FBI fame) and Neil Kavanagh (Edisson Lighthouse).
